Blocking all calls for the RingCentral assigned phone number

I have a main company number that I use for my business that I give out to all my contacts.  I also have the RingCentral given number that I do not use and do not give out to anyone.  However, I get substantial amount of unsolicited calls and faxes through this number that are annoying and disrupting to my business.
How can I block all calls to this number while still getting calls made to my company main number.  I called tech support and they tell me this feature is not available. Come on!! Isn't this a software company?  
Any suggestions/solutions?

Ernesto,

Sure you can. Select the extension that number is assigned to then go to Screening, Greeting & Hold Music...then Blocked Calls. Click on the radio button which says Block all calls.

Assuming your extension is the super admin, you cannot do it through blocked calls (since it will block calls to your main number too).  You'll need to do it via advanced rules under your extension.
